Natural Substrates/ Products (Substrates)

EC Number Natural Substrates Organism Comment (Nat. Sub.) Natural Products Comment (Nat. Pro.) Rev. Reac.
2.3.1.84 isoamylalcohol + acetyl-CoA Saccharomyces cerevisiae alcohol acetyltransferase 2 is probably the key enzyme in a steroid detoxification mechanism, alcohol acetyltransferase 1 accounts for 80% of isoamyl acetate production and 30% of ethyl acetate production and might be involved in fatty acid metabolism isoamyl acetate + CoA
